Historically, GCompris was completely free and open-source (FOSS) in every sense, relying solely on donations. However, as the project grew, the development team faced a classic open-source problem: sustainability. Maintaining over 150 activities, translating them into more than 50 languages, and providing support across Windows, macOS, Android, and Linux requires significant financial resources.
